Técnico en Desarrollo y Ciberseguridad
> Llevo más de 15 años viviendo en Linux profesionalmente y aún sigo en el viaje.
No importa cuál es tu background técnico: Linux es la base.
Domina la línea de comandos, automatiza con bash scripting y descubre Linux real conmigo.
Soy tan majo que te indexo aquí (casi)todos mis recursos...
| TÍTULO | FECHA | TAGS | LINKS |
|---|---|---|---|
|
#!Bash 30 - Sustitución de comandos) #!Bash 30 - Sustitución de comandos, simplificacion de comandos compuestos a simples: asignaciones y comandos simples, orden de prevalencia entre alias, shell functions y binarios. |
2024-07-12 | #bash_serie #bash #scripting #$(...) #shell_expansion #~ #$((...)) #declare #alias #shell_function #path #hash | |
|
Bash reverse shell Entendemos los parámetros de una reverse shell de bash con ejemplos |
2024-07-10 | #bash #reverse_shell #nc #>& #> | |
|
#!Bash 29 - Funciones en la shell) #!Bash 29 - Declarar funciones en la shell. Parámetros pasados de forma posicional. Variables dentro de una función. Palabra reservada 'local', visibilidad de variables (shadowing), comando declare para ver el listado de las funciones definidas en la shell |
2024-07-04 | #bash_serie #bash #scripting #$n #shell_function #$* #$@ #$# #$? #$- #$$ #$0 #$! #declare | |
|
#!Bash 27 - Shell interactiva y login shell #!Bash 27 - Diferencia entre shell interactiva y shell no interactiva. Flags de una shell ($-) Diferencia entre una login shell o no login shell. Ficheros especiales de inicio de la shell. |
2024-06-18 | #bash_serie #bash #scripting #shell #$- #.bashrc #.bash_profile #& | |
|
Linux Explained: Directorio /bin Directorio BIN de Linux explicado |
2024-05-19 | #linux_explained #humor #cat #shell #ls #rm #path | |
|
#!Bash 22 - Comparaciones con test y [...] #!Bash 22 - Comparaciones sencillas en bash. Test y [...]. Usa $? para comprobar el estado de salida del comando anterior. Se pueden combinar los tests con operadores lógicos para complicar más los tests. |
2024-05-09 | #bash_serie #bash #scripting #... #test #arithmetic_expansion #&& #|| #command_substitution #shell_expansion | |
|
#!Bash 21 - Agrupaciones de comandos #!Bash 21 - Agrupaciones de comandos con (...) y {...}. Domina las subshells |
2024-05-01 | #bash_serie #bash #scripting #subshell #(...) #{...} | |
|
CmdChallenge #40: Rosa Elimina los ficheros del directorio que empiezan con un - |
2024-04-16 | #cmdchallenge #rm #find #filename_expansion #shell_expansion | |
|
#!Bash 17 - Edición de línea Ctrl y Alt + ... #!Bash 17 - Usa los atajos de la shell para ser un águila escribiendo en la shell de Linux, el camino del cervatillo, la gacela y el León... edita la linea de comandos como un pro. |
2024-04-03 | #bash_serie #bash #scripting #shell #atajo | |
|
CmdChallenge #39: Florecilla rosa Elimina ficheros de un directorio recursivamente que NO tengan la extensión *.txt mi *.exe (Solucion 1 con tres variantes y solución 2 con sustitución de comandos) |
2024-04-02 | #cmdchallenge #find #grep #xargs #command_substitution #shell_expansion |
Hola, me llamo Juan y soy técnico en ciberseguridad. Tengo años de experiencia como analista de amenazas, investigador forense y desarrollador de software - adoro scrum.
Llevo un tiempo creando contenido poniendo el foco en Linux, el terminal, Bash scripting y ciberseguridad con un toque de humor.